Output 2c40869456257c56f60a3c07b0b645c64aae0b4d552ff8c381322dbf80030d39:2

value
3107310
script pubkey
OP_0 OP_PUSHBYTES_20 4c4111bfe030ec7e133d8cbec821a64f990ed144
address
bc1qf3q3r0lqxrk8uyea3jlvsgdxf7vsa52yqzvqxh
transaction
2c40869456257c56f60a3c07b0b645c64aae0b4d552ff8c381322dbf80030d39
confirmations
102488
spent
true